Chữ Bị Tràn Màn Hình Máy Tính

Máy Tính Chữ Bị Tràn Màn Hình Máy Tính

Nhập thông tin dưới đây để tính toán nguyên nhân và giải pháp cho vấn đề chữ bị tràn màn hình

Nguyên nhân chính:
Đang tính toán…
Giải pháp khuyến nghị:
Cài đặt tối ưu:
Đang tính toán…
Mức độ nghiêm trọng:
Đang tính toán…

Hướng Dẫn Chi Tiết: Khắc Phục Lỗi Chữ Bị Tràn Màn Hình Máy Tính

Vấn đề chữ bị tràn màn hình (text overflow) là một trong những lỗi hiển thị phổ biến nhất mà người dùng máy tính gặp phải. Lỗi này xảy ra khi văn bản vượt quá giới hạn của khung chứa, khiến một phần hoặc toàn bộ nội dung không hiển thị đúng cách. Bài viết này sẽ cung cấp phân tích chuyên sâu về nguyên nhân, giải pháp và các phương pháp phòng ngừa hiệu quả.

1. Nguyên Nhân Chính Gây Ra Lỗi Chữ Tràn Màn Hình

Có nhiều yếu tố kỹ thuật có thể dẫn đến tình trạng chữ bị tràn màn hình. Dưới đây là phân tích chi tiết về các nguyên nhân phổ biến:

  • Cài đặt DPI không phù hợp: Tỷ lệ DPI (dots per inch) quá cao so với độ phân giải màn hình thực tế sẽ làm cho hệ thống cố gắng hiển thị quá nhiều pixel trong một diện tích nhỏ, dẫn đến hiện tượng tràn.
  • Cỡ chữ hệ thống quá lớn: Khi cài đặt cỡ chữ mặc định của hệ điều hành vượt quá 125% so với tiêu chuẩn, nhiều ứng dụng không được tối ưu hóa sẽ gặp vấn đề hiển thị.
  • Lỗi CSS trong trang web: Đối với trình duyệt, các thuộc tính CSS như white-space: nowrap, overflow: visible hoặc width cố định có thể gây tràn văn bản.
  • Driver card màn hình lỗi thời: Driver cũ không hỗ trợ chính xác các chế độ hiển thị hiện đại, đặc biệt trên màn hình có tỷ lệ khung hình không chuẩn (như 21:9).
  • Xung đột phần mềm: Một số ứng dụng điều khiển hiển thị của bên thứ ba (như f.lux, DisplayFusion) có thể can thiệp vào cơ chế render văn bản.

2. Phân Tích Theo Hệ Điều Hành

Mỗi hệ điều hành xử lý vấn đề hiển thị văn bản theo cách khác nhau. Dưới đây là bảng so sánh chi tiết:

Hệ Điều Hành Nguyên Nhân Phổ Biến Giải Pháp Hiệu Quả Nhất Tỷ Lệ Gặp Lỗi (2023)
Windows 11 DPI scaling tự động cho ứng dụng cũ Vô hiệu hóa “Let Windows fix apps so they’re not blurry” 32%
Windows 10 Xung đột giữa cài đặt hiển thị và ứng dụng Đặt DPI scaling thành 100% cho ứng dụng cụ thể 41%
macOS Cài đặt “Scaled” resolution không phù hợp Chọn “Default for display” trong System Preferences 18%
Linux (GNOME/KDE) Font DPI được cấu hình sai trong xorg.conf Chỉnh sửa tệp cấu hình hoặc sử dụng gsettings 25%

3. Giải Pháp Theo Loại Ứng Dụng

  1. Đối với trình duyệt web:
    • Nhấn Ctrl + 0 để reset zoom về 100%
    • Vô hiệu hóa tạm thời extension bằng cách gõ chrome://extensions (Chrome) hoặc about:addons (Firefox)
    • Sử dụng chế độ “Reader View” (F9 trong Firefox) để loại bỏ CSS gây xung đột
    • Thay đổi cài đặt font mặc định trong chrome://settings/appearance
  2. Đối với phần mềm desktop:
    • Click chuột phải vào shortcut → Properties → Compatibility → Change high DPI settings
    • Chọn “Override high DPI scaling behavior” và thử các tùy chọn khác nhau
    • Cập nhật phần mềm lên phiên bản mới nhất (nhà phát triển thường sửa lỗi hiển thị)
    • Thay đổi cài đặt font trong tùy chọn của ứng dụng (nếu có)
  3. Đối với trò chơi:
    • Thay đổi tệp cấu hình game (thường là .ini) để điều chỉnh UI scale
    • Chạy game ở chế độ windowed thay vì fullscreen
    • Cài đặt mod UI (như Dear ImGui cho một số game)
    • Giảm độ phân giải render trong cài đặt đồ họa

4. Các Công Cụ Chẩn Đoán Nâng Cao

Đối với người dùng nâng cao, các công cụ sau sẽ giúp chẩn đoán chính xác nguyên nhân:

  • Windows:
    • Display Settings Analyzer: Sử dụng PowerShell cmdlet Get-DisplayResolution để kiểm tra cài đặt hiển thị hiện tại
    • DPI Awareness: Sử dụng Process Explorer từ Sysinternals để kiểm tra mức độ nhận thức DPI của ứng dụng
    • Windows Magnifier: Phóng to các vùng cụ thể để xác định vị trí tràn chính xác
  • Web Development:
    • F12 Developer Tools → Elements → kiểm tra thuộc tính overflowwidth
    • Console tab → gõ getComputedStyle(element).getPropertyValue('width')
    • Sử dụng extension “WhatFont” để xác định font problem
  • Linux:
    • xrandr --current để kiểm tra cài đặt hiển thị
    • fc-match sans để kiểm tra font hệ thống
    • dconf watch / để theo dõi thay đổi cài đặt thời gian thực

5. Phòng Ngừa Lỗi Tràn Văn Bản

Để ngăn chặn vấn đề tái phát, bạn nên áp dụng các biện pháp phòng ngừa sau:

Biện Pháp Mô Tả Tần Suất Thực Hiện
Cập nhật driver Luôn giữ driver card màn hình và chipset mới nhất từ nhà sản xuất Hàng quý
Kiểm tra cài đặt DPI Đảm bảo tỷ lệ DPI phù hợp với độ phân giải vật lý của màn hình Khi thay đổi màn hình
Sao lưu profile màu Lưu cài đặt ICC profile để khôi phục khi cần thiết Khi cấu hình mới
Kiểm tra tương thích ứng dụng Chạy ứng dụng ở chế độ compatibility mode nếu cần Khi cài đặt ứng dụng cũ
Dọn dẹp font hệ thống Gỡ bỏ font không sử dụng để tránh xung đột 6 tháng/lần

6. Các Lỗi Phổ Biến và Cách Khắc Phục Nhanh

Dưới đây là danh sách các tình huống cụ thể và giải pháp tương ứng:

  1. Chữ bị cắt xén ở cạnh màn hình:
    • Giảm tỷ lệ DPI xuống còn 100%
    • Kiểm tra cài đặt overscan trong card màn hình (NVIDIA/AMD control panel)
    • Thay đổi độ phân giải về native resolution của màn hình
  2. Chữ bị nhòe và tràn trong game:
    • Vô hiệu hóa anti-aliasing trong cài đặt đồ họa
    • Thay đổi tệp cấu hình game để điều chỉnh UI scale
    • Cập nhật DirectX và Visual C++ Redistributable
  3. Trang web hiển thị sai layout:
    • Nhấn Ctrl + Shift + M (Chrome) để chuyển sang mobile view
    • Xóa cache trình duyệt (Ctrl + Shift + Del)
    • Thử trình duyệt khác (Firefox/Edge) để xác định lỗi cụ thể
  4. Chữ bị tràn trong ứng dụng cũ:
    • Chạy ở chế độ compatibility mode (Windows XP/7)
    • Thay đổi cài đặt “Disable display scaling on high DPI settings”
    • Sử dụng phần mềm ảo hóa như Windows XP Mode

7. Các Thuật Ngữ Kỹ Thuật Liên Quan

Để hiểu sâu hơn về vấn đề, bạn nên làm quen với các thuật ngữ sau:

  • DPI (Dots Per Inch): Đơn vị đo mật độ điểm ảnh, ảnh hưởng trực tiếp đến kích thước hiển thị của văn bản
  • PPI (Pixels Per Inch): Tương tự DPI nhưng đo trên màn hình thực tế, quyết định độ sắc nét
  • Scaling Factor: Tỷ lệ phóng to/thu nhỏ giao diện người dùng so với kích thước gốc
  • Subpixel Rendering: Kỹ thuật sử dụng các pixel con (RGB) để làm mượt font, có thể gây hiện tượng màu ở cạnh chữ
  • ClearType: Công nghệ làm mượt font của Microsoft, tối ưu cho màn hình LCD
  • GPU Acceleration: Sử dụng card đồ họa để render văn bản, có thể gây xung đột với một số ứng dụng
  • CSS Box Model: Mô hình định nghĩa cách tính toán kích thước phần tử trong trình duyệt

8. Các Câu Hỏi Thường Gặp

Q: Tại sao chữ chỉ bị tràn ở một số ứng dụng cụ thể?

A: Điều này thường xảy ra khi ứng dụng không được tối ưu hóa cho DPI cao (non-DPI-aware). Các ứng dụng cũ (trước Windows Vista) thường gặp vấn đề này vì chúng giả định màn hình luôn có DPI 96.

Q: Làm sao để biết ứng dụng nào đang gây xung đột hiển thị?

A: Sử dụng Task Manager → Performance tab → GPU để kiểm tra ứng dụng nào đang sử dụng tài nguyên đồ họa bất thường. Hoặc dùng Process Explorer từ Sysinternals để phân tích chi tiết.

Q: Tại sao sau khi cập nhật Windows, chữ bị tràn nhiều hơn?

A: Windows Update đôi khi thay đổi cài đặt DPI mặc định hoặc driver hiển thị. Kiểm tra Windows Update History và gỡ bỏ bản cập nhật gần đây nếu cần.

Q: Có cách nào reset tất cả cài đặt hiển thị về mặc định?

A: Trong Windows, bạn có thể sử dụng lệnh display switch /internal trong Command Prompt (admin). Trên macOS, giữ Option + click vào “Scaled” trong Display Preferences để xem tùy chọn mặc định.

Q: Làm sao để kiểm tra xem màn hình của tôi có hỗ trợ DPI cao?

A: Truy cập trang web WhatIsMyDPI.com hoặc sử dụng công cụ DisplayX từ Microsoft Store để kiểm tra thông số kỹ thuật của màn hình.

Leave a Reply

Your email address will not be published. Required fields are marked *